The Kia Cerato (also known as the Kia Forte in North America, K3 in South Korea or the Forte K3 or Shuma in China) is a compact car produced by the South Korean manufacturer Kia since 2003. In 2008, the Cerato nameplate was replaced by the Forte nameplate in the North American market and the K3 nameplate in South Korea. However, the "Cerato" name remains in use in markets such as Australasia, Middle East and Latin America. It is available in five-door hatchback, two-door coupe and four-door sedan variants. As of 2025 Q4, 825 KIA CERATO were still registered in the UK — 436 licensed and on the road, plus 389 declared SORN (off-road). The figures come from official DVLA vehicle licensing data.

Most KIA CERATO run on petrol — about 81% of those still registered, with the rest split across diesel, gas (lpg).
